Output 2e72108d5616853d3aeece829e71e9b7d56d8d9dc62d70d5bf69fcb47a23f5a7:8

value
24913306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6c0583767752928e8609be77833c9698f3573e OP_EQUAL
address
3Eanc4RWrczTHECaDVm74RvbocYsmbrCV2
transaction
2e72108d5616853d3aeece829e71e9b7d56d8d9dc62d70d5bf69fcb47a23f5a7
spent
true